This may indeed solve the problem. To contact a Jeremie
registry running on the local machine, either specify the name
of the machine, or its IP address, or (rather surprisingly) don't
specify anything at all. For example, "jrmi://" will contact a
Jeremie registry running on the local machine on the default port
12340.
In the next version of Jeremie, we'll correct this problem with
the use of "localhost".
